一种多路同步回放方法和装置制造方法及图纸

技术编号:11570660 阅读:109 留言:0更新日期:2015-06-10 01:17
本发明专利技术公开了一种多路同步回放方法和装置:确定回放时间段以及需要进行多路同步回放的M个通道,M为大于1的正整数;针对每个通道,分别从该通道对应的录像文件中查找出与所述回放时间段相符合的录像文件;根据查找出的各录像文件的开始时间和结束时间,分别确定出所述回放时间段内的不同子时段内作为主通道的通道,每个子时段内作为主通道的通道均存在要回放的录像文件;根据确定结果,按照不同子时段动态切换主通道的方式进行多路同步回放。应用本发明专利技术所述方案,能够提高录像文件的查找效率等。

【技术实现步骤摘要】

本专利技术涉及视频监控领域,特别涉及一种多路同步回放方法和装置
技术介绍
现有的数字硬盘录像机(DVR, Digital Video Recorder)等均具备多路同步回放功能。多路即指DVR的多个视频通道,一路代表一个通道;同步回放即指可同时回放多个通道在同一时间段内的录像文件,各通道的回放时间与主通道保持同步;相应地,主通道即指多路同步回放过程中作为参考标准的一个通道。多路同步回放技术主要用于大量的录像文件查找。比如:在1:00?3:00这一时间段内有异常情况发生,那么则需要回放1:00?3:00这个时间段内的所有监控点的录像文件,以查找具体的异常地点和原因等。在实际应用中,为了节省硬盘的存储空间等,对于每个通道来说,其通常都不会24小时一直进行录像,而是间歇性地进行录像,如当每次满足预先设定的录像条件时,则进行录像,并生成一个录像文件。另外,按照现有多路同步回放技术的实现方式,在开始进行多路同步回放之前,即需要先确定出主通道,可以由用户指定,也可以由DVR按照某一规则选定,而且,一旦确定将某一通道作为主通道,那么在整个多路同步回放过程中,该通道就将一直作为主通道,而不会变更为其它通道。这样一来,如果在指定的回放时间段内,主通道一直存在要回放的录像文件,那么其它通道的录像文件也都可以进行回放,但如果主通道在某一子时段内不存在要回放的录像文件,即主通道在该子时段内未进行录像,那么由于其它通道的回放时间需要与主通道保持同步,因此其它通道即使存在要回放的录像文件,也将无法进行回放,从而降低了录像文件的查找效率。比如:用户指定的回放时间段为1:00?3:00,并指定了 16个通道同时进行回放,且指定通道2作为主通道,但是通道2在2:00?3:00这一子时段内不存在要回放的录像文件,那么整个回放过程只能在2:00时就结束,相应地,其它通道在2:00?3:00这一子时段内的录像文件均将无法进行回放。
技术实现思路
有鉴于此,本专利技术提供了一种多路同步回放方法和装置,能够提高录像的查找效率。为了达到上述目的,本专利技术的技术方案是这样实现的:一种多路同步回放方法,包括:确定回放时间段以及需要进行多路同步回放的M个通道,M为大于I的正整数;针对每个通道,分别从该通道对应的录像文件中查找出与所述回放时间段相符合的录像文件;根据查找出的各录像文件的开始时间和结束时间,分别确定出所述回放时间段内的不同子时段内作为主通道的通道,每个子时段内作为主通道的通道均存在要回放的录像文件;根据确定结果,按照不同子时段动态切换主通道的方式进行多路同步回放。一种多路同步回放装置,包括:第一处理模块,用于确定回放时间段以及需要进行多路同步回放的M个通道,M为大于I的正整数,并通知给第二处理模块;所述第二处理模块,用于针对每个通道,分别从该通道对应的录像文件中查找出与所述回放时间段相符合的录像文件;根据查找出的各录像文件的开始时间和结束时间,分别确定出所述回放时间段内的不同子时段内作为主通道的通道,每个子时段内作为主通道的通道均存在要回放的录像文件;根据确定结果,按照不同子时段动态切换主通道的方式进行多路同步回放。可见,采用本专利技术所述方案,整个多路同步回放过程中不再只使用一个固定不变的主通道,而是按照不同子时段动态切换主通道的方式进行多路同步回放,从而尽可能地使得回放时间段内的所有录像文件均能进行回放,进而提高了录像文件的查找效率。【附图说明】图1为本专利技术多路同步回放方法实施例的流程图。图2为本专利技术播放文件列表的示意图。图3为本专利技术主通道动态切换方式示意图。图4为本专利技术多路同步回放装置实施例的组成结构示意图。【具体实施方式】为了使本专利技术的技术方案更加清楚、明白,以下参照附图并举实施例,对本专利技术所述方案作进一步的详细说明。图1为本专利技术多路同步回放方法实施例的流程图。如图1所示,包括以下步骤11 ?14。步骤11:确定回放时间段以及需要进行多路同步回放的M个通道,M为大于I的正整数。回放时间段以及需要进行多路同步回放的通道均可由用户设定。步骤12:针对每个通道,分别从该通道对应的录像文件中查找出与回放时间段相符合的录像文件。本步骤中,针对每个通道,可分别进行以下处理:a、针对该通道对应的每个录像文件,分别确定该录像文件的开始时间和结束时间限定出的时间段与回放时间段之间是否存在重叠,如果是,则将该录像文件确定为与回放时间段相符合的录像文件;b、确定与回放时间段相符合的录像文件的总个数是否为0,如果否,则生成该通道的播放文件列表,播放文件列表中可包括:该通道的通道号、每个与回放时间段相符合的录像文件的预定信息,所述预定信息包括:开始时间和结束时间,如果是,则可结束处理。对于每个录像文件来说,该录像文件的开始时间和结束时间限定出的时间段与回放时间段之间存在重叠可以是指部分重叠,也可以是指完全重叠。举例说明:回放时间段为1:00?3:00,某一录像文件的开始时间和结束时间分别为12:50和2:00,那么该录像文件的开始时间和结束时间限定出的时间段与回放时间段之间则是部分重叠;同样,回放时间段为1:00?3:00,某一录像文件的开始时间和结束时间分别为1:00和3:00,那么该录像文件的开始时间和结束时间限定出的时间段与回放时间段之间则是完全重叠。对于每个通道来说,其对应的与回放时间段相符合的录像文件的总个数可能为一个,也可能为多个,还可能为O个。如果是O个,则可不作处理;如果是一个或多个,则需要生成该通道的播放文件列表,播放文件列表中可包括:该通道的通道号、每个与回放时间段相符合的录像文件的预定信息,所述预定信息可包括:开始时间和结束时间。另外,所述预定信息还可进一步包括:录像文件的类型、录像文件的存储地址(在硬盘中的存储地址)以及录像文件的长度等,后续可根据这些信息相应地进行录像文件的回放。图2为本专利技术播放文件列表的示意图。如图2所示,假设共存在M个播放文件列表,分别对应于通道号为I?M的M个通道,η表示每个通道对应的与回放时间段相符合的录像文件的总个数,为正整数。步骤13:根据查找出的各录像文件的开始时间和结束时间,分别确定出回放时间段内的不同子时段内作为主通道的通道,每个子时段内作为主通道的通道均存在要回放的录像文件。本步骤的具体实现方式可为:A、将回放时间段的开始时间作为参考时间,并将查找出的各录像文件作为查找范围;B、确定查找范围中是否存在开始时间早于或等于参考时间的录像文件;如果是,则将一个开始时间早于或等于参考时间的录像文件作为最新的参考文件;如果否,则从查找范围中确定出开始时间与参考时间距离最近的录像文件,并将其作为最新的参考文件;将最新的参考文件对应的通道确定为主通道,并生成一条主通道信息,加入到主通道列表中,该主通道信息中包括:该主通道的开始时间、该主通道的结束时间,以及该主通道的通道号;当最新的参考文件的开始时间早于或等于参考时间、且结束时间等于或晚于回放时间段的结束时间时,该主通道的开始时间为参考时间,该主通道的结束时间为回放时间段的结束时间;当最新的参考文件的开始时间晚于参考时间、且结束时间等于或晚于回放时间段的结束时间时,该主通道的开始时间为最新的参考文件的开始时间,该主通道的结束时间为回放时间段的结束时间本文档来自技高网
...
一种多路同步回放方法和装置

【技术保护点】
一种多路同步回放方法,其特征在于,包括:确定回放时间段以及需要进行多路同步回放的M个通道,M为大于1的正整数;针对每个通道,分别从该通道对应的录像文件中查找出与所述回放时间段相符合的录像文件;根据查找出的各录像文件的开始时间和结束时间,分别确定出所述回放时间段内的不同子时段内作为主通道的通道,每个子时段内作为主通道的通道均存在要回放的录像文件;根据确定结果,按照不同子时段动态切换主通道的方式进行多路同步回放。

【技术特征摘要】

【专利技术属性】
技术研发人员:冀建成卓庭亮周文省刘彦
申请(专利权)人:杭州海康威视数字技术股份有限公司
类型:发明
国别省市:浙江;33

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1